What is a direct cremation?

Direct cremation is a cremation that takes place without a formal funeral service beforehand. Your loved one is respectfully cared for, brought into our care and cremated, and their ashes are then returned to the family to arrange a private farewell, memorial or scattering.

  • There is no chapel service or viewing at the crematorium included in a direct cremation.

  • Families are free to arrange a separate memorial at home, in a community venue or at any special place that feels right.

What’s included in a direct cremation.

Each direct cremation arrangement covers the key professional services required for a dignified farewell. You can choose to include any additional elements that feel right for your family whenever you are ready.

  • Professional transfer of your loved one into our care from home, hospital or nursing home.
  • Mortuary care and preparation, a simple coffin suitable for cremation, and required paperwork.
  • Cremation carried out at Karrakatta Cemetery, with ashes returned to you in a simple urn or container.

How direct cremations work in Floreat

We’ve designed the process to be simple and compassionate, with clear support at each stage.

  1. First contact

    • Call us 24/7 to let us know someone has died or is expected to die soon, and we will explain the next steps in plain language.

  2. Transfer into our care

    • Our team will arrange to bring your loved one into our care from home, hospital, nursing home or coroner, and keep you informed as things progress.

  3. Paperwork and planning

    • We help you complete all required forms and discuss any choices, such as who will collect the ashes and whether you plan a later memorial.

  4. Cremation and return of ashes

    • The cremation takes place on an agreed timeframe, and ashes are returned to you or a nominated person so you can hold a private farewell, scattering or celebration of life.
